How much do cook j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average hourly pay for cook in Kenosha, WI is $15.65,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.12 and $17.60 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a cook do?

A Cook—also called a Chef—is ultimately responsible for preparing the food that is served in restaurants or other dining establishments. As the head of the kitchen, Cooks also supervise other work and oversee the kitchen to ensure it all runs smoothly. In some restaurants, Cooks are responsible for creating recipes and menus, planning events, ensuring that food and kitchen regulations are followed, and sticking to a restaurant budget. There are different levels of this position that you can earn, meaning that there can be a wide range to all the potential possibilities and responsibilities of a daily Cook. For example, there’s the Head Chef who runs the kitchen while the other Cooks are responsible for specific types of food.

What does a cook do?

A cook is responsible for preparing and cooking food in restaurants, cafeterias, or other food service establishments. Their duties include following recipes, measuring ingredients, operating kitchen equipment, and ensuring food safety and cleanliness. Cooks may also help with menu planning, inventory management, and maintaining kitchen supplies. They work closely with other kitchen staff to deliver meals efficiently and meet customer expectations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a cook,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Cook, you need a solid grasp of culinary techniques, food safety standards, and menu preparation, often supported by a high school diploma or culinary training. Familiarity with commercial kitchen equipment, inventory systems, and certifications like ServSafe are typically required. Strong time management, teamwork, and attention to detail help Cooks stand out in busy kitchen environments. These skills and qualities are crucial for consistently delivering safe, high-quality dishes and maintaining efficient kitchen operations.

What are some common challenges cooks face during busy service hours, and how can they effectively manage them?

During peak service times, cooks often encounter challenges such as time pressure, managing multiple orders simultaneously, and maintaining high standards of food quality and presentation. Effective communication with team members and staying organized are crucial for keeping up with the pace. Many cooks use strategies like prepping ingredients in advance, prioritizing tasks, and maintaining a clean workstation to ensure smooth workflow and minimize mistakes. Developing these habits helps cooks deliver consistent results even in high-stress environments.

What is the difference between Cook vs Chef?

AspectCookChef
CredentialsNone required or basic culinary trainingFormal culinary education or extensive experience
Work EnvironmentRestaurants, cafeterias, cateringFine dining, hotels, culinary establishments
ResponsibilitiesPreparing dishes, following recipesMenu creation, kitchen management, supervising cooks

In summary, a Cook typically prepares food following established recipes and has minimal formal training, while a Chef often has specialized culinary education and takes on leadership roles in the kitchen, overseeing cooking staff and menu development.

What jobs can you do if you like cooking?

If you enjoy cooking, you can pursue roles such as chef, line cook, pastry chef, or culinary assistant. These jobs typically require culinary skills, knowledge of food safety, and sometimes certifications like a food handler's permit. Opportunities exist in restaurants, hotels, catering companies, and institutional food services.

A Wingstop cook is responsible to prepare quality food that tastes great and is consistent from day-to-day. This position is critical to Wingstop Restaurants; ensuring compliance with company standards in all areas of operation, including product preparation maintaining the highest quality products and services are delivered to each customer; follows and comprehends the importance of proper personal hygiene and sanitation procedures. The restaurant cook must be able to successfully focus on their job in a calm, yet efficient manner.

Essential Duties & Responsibilities:

Ensure that each guest has a positive, long lasting impression of the Wingstop

experience

Ability to practice safe cooking procedures

Quickly scan and comprehend the order tickets

Accurately count the number of Bone-In Wings, Boneless Wings and Boneless

Strips needed for each order

Coordinate the cooking time of Bone-In Wings, Boneless Wings and Boneless

Strips and fries with the corresponding timer

According to Wingstop standards; Sauce, Season and package all orders

Accurately count the cooked Bone-In Wings, Boneless Wings and Boneless

Strips into the proper sauce bowls

Cook and prepare Bone-In Wings, Boneless Wings and Boneless Strips, and

Fries in the proper fryers and baskets

Filter and freshen the fryer shortening daily, following all safety procedures and

with proper safety equipment

Assist in keeping the kitchen clean throughout the shift maintaining clean as you

go and at closing time

Immediately notify Manager on Duty of all safety, sanitation, or employee issues

Assist other employees as needed

Follow directions given by Manager or Supervisor

Know and thoroughly understand the importance of good hygiene and food

handling practices

Ability to thoroughly understand and follow instructions in how to properly and

safely use chemical cleaning products

Wingstop Inc. is a prominent player in the fast-casual dining industry, headquartered in Dallas, TX, USA. The company specializes in chicken wings, and its menu boasts a variety of flavors from spicy to sweet. Wingstop was founded in 1994 with a mission to serve the world flavor. Their commitment to this mission has earned them significant recognition with a presence across all 50 states and 9 countries, marking them as a leader in their industry. The company's core values, prominently displayed on their website, include being service minded, authentic, and fun. They prioritize quality, focusing on fresh, made-to-order wings and exceptional customer experience.
